Output 755034853f380a0599e08233c3d6c4988efdf51ab59b6cd5145b25d5b0a78e26:1

value
167947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a680ff45088fa4112a6f30d15d90b98d37117899 OP_EQUAL
address
3GsQdGQovb6HhY3yPhZRMc3T3m1SzihLEb
transaction
755034853f380a0599e08233c3d6c4988efdf51ab59b6cd5145b25d5b0a78e26
spent
true